8 security personnel killed in Nagaland militant ambush

Eight security personnel were killed on Sunday in an ambush by underground militants in Mon district of Nagaland, defence sources said.

Seven Assam Rifles personnel and a Territorial Army jawan lost their lives as they were fired upon by underground militants when they had gone to Changlansu in Mon district with water tankers to fetch water, the sources said.

The Assam Rifles personnel also fired back and one underground militant was killed while some others were injured in the ensuing encounter, they added.
